博客 指标归因分析的技术实现与数据处理方法

指标归因分析的技术实现与数据处理方法

   数栈君   发表于 2026-03-09 21:24  50  0

在当今数据驱动的商业环境中,企业越来越依赖数据分析来优化决策、提升效率并实现业务目标。指标归因分析作为一种重要的数据分析方法,帮助企业从复杂的业务数据中识别关键驱动因素,量化各因素对业务结果的影响。本文将深入探讨指标归因分析的技术实现与数据处理方法,为企业提供实用的指导。


什么是指标归因分析?

指标归因分析(Metric Attributions Analysis)是一种通过统计方法和机器学习技术,量化各个因素对业务指标贡献程度的分析方法。其核心目标是回答以下问题:

  • 哪些因素对业务指标的增长或下降贡献最大?
  • 各个因素之间的相互作用如何影响最终结果?
  • 如何通过优化关键因素来提升业务表现?

通过指标归因分析,企业可以更精准地制定策略,优化资源配置,并预测未来的业务趋势。


指标归因分析的实现步骤

指标归因分析的实现通常包括以下几个关键步骤:

1. 数据准备与清洗

数据是指标归因分析的基础。在进行分析之前,需要对数据进行清洗和预处理,确保数据的完整性和准确性。

  • 数据清洗:处理缺失值、异常值和重复数据。例如,对于缺失值,可以采用填充(如均值、中位数)或删除的方法;对于异常值,可以通过统计方法(如Z-score)或机器学习方法(如Isolation Forest)进行识别和处理。
  • 数据集成:将来自不同数据源(如数据库、日志文件、第三方API)的相关数据进行整合,确保数据的统一性和一致性。

2. 特征工程

特征工程是指标归因分析中至关重要的一环。通过构建合适的特征,可以更好地捕捉业务逻辑和数据规律。

  • 特征提取:从原始数据中提取有意义的特征。例如,从用户行为日志中提取“用户活跃天数”、“点击率”等特征。
  • 特征工程化:对特征进行标准化、归一化或其他变换,以满足模型输入的要求。例如,使用One-Hot编码处理类别变量,或使用PCA进行降维。

3. 模型选择与训练

根据业务需求和数据特点,选择合适的模型进行训练。

  • 线性回归模型:适用于因果关系较为线性的场景,如销售预测。
  • 随机森林/梯度提升树:适用于非线性关系,能够处理高维数据和特征交互。
  • 因果推断模型:如倾向评分匹配(Propensity Score Matching)或工具变量法(Instrumental Variables),适用于需要严格因果关系的场景。

4. 结果解释与验证

模型训练完成后,需要对结果进行解释和验证。

  • 贡献度计算:通过模型输出,计算每个因素对业务指标的贡献度。例如,在线性回归模型中,特征的系数可以直接反映其对目标变量的贡献。
  • 结果验证:通过交叉验证、A/B测试等方法,验证模型的稳定性和可靠性。

数据处理方法

在指标归因分析中,数据处理是确保分析结果准确性的关键。以下是常用的数据处理方法:

1. 数据集成

数据集成是将多个数据源中的数据合并到一个统一的数据集中的过程。常见的数据集成方法包括:

  • 基于规则的集成:根据业务规则(如时间戳、唯一标识符)进行数据匹配和合并。
  • 基于机器学习的集成:使用聚类、分类等方法对数据进行自动匹配和合并。

2. 数据预处理

数据预处理是数据清洗和特征工程的结合体,旨在提高数据质量并为模型提供友好的输入。

  • 缺失值处理:使用均值、中位数或模型预测填充缺失值。
  • 异常值处理:通过统计方法或机器学习方法识别并处理异常值。
  • 数据标准化:对特征进行标准化或归一化处理,使其具有相似的尺度。

3. 数据增强

数据增强是通过生成新数据或变换现有数据,增加数据集的多样性和丰富性。

  • 数据生成:通过模拟实验或业务场景生成合成数据。
  • 数据变换:对现有数据进行变换(如对数变换、分箱)以更好地反映业务规律。

可视化与决策支持

指标归因分析的最终目的是为决策提供支持。通过数据可视化,可以更直观地展示分析结果,帮助业务人员理解复杂的分析结论。

1. 数据可视化

  • 柱状图:展示各因素对业务指标的贡献度。
  • 折线图:展示业务指标随时间的变化趋势。
  • 热力图:展示各因素对业务指标的交互影响。

2. 数据仪表盘

通过构建数据仪表盘,企业可以实时监控业务指标的变化,并根据归因分析结果快速调整策略。

  • 实时监控:通过数据可视化工具(如Tableau、Power BI)实时展示业务指标。
  • 预警系统:设置阈值和预警规则,及时发现异常情况。

应用场景

指标归因分析在多个业务场景中具有广泛的应用:

1. 市场营销

  • 广告效果评估:量化不同广告渠道对销售额的贡献。
  • 客户行为分析:识别影响客户转化率的关键因素。

2. 产品优化

  • 功能使用分析:分析用户使用不同功能对产品活跃度的贡献。
  • 版本迭代:通过A/B测试评估新功能对用户留存率的影响。

3. 供应链管理

  • 库存优化:分析影响库存周转率的关键因素。
  • 物流效率:识别影响物流成本的主要因素。

结论

指标归因分析是一种强大的数据分析方法,能够帮助企业从复杂的业务数据中识别关键驱动因素,量化各因素对业务结果的影响。通过数据准备、特征工程、模型选择与训练、结果解释与验证等步骤,企业可以更精准地制定策略,优化资源配置,并预测未来的业务趋势。

如果您希望进一步了解指标归因分析的技术实现与数据处理方法,欢迎申请试用我们的数据分析平台:申请试用。我们的平台提供强大的数据处理和分析功能,帮助您轻松实现指标归因分析。

广告:通过我们的数据分析平台,您可以轻松实现指标归因分析,优化业务决策。

广告:立即申请试用,体验高效的数据分析功能。

广告:让数据驱动您的业务成功,申请试用我们的数据分析平台。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料